The Non-Statin Guide to Healthier Lipids

LDL running high? Use food, movement, fiber, and smart habits to improve lipids without leaning on statins. Here is a clear plan that actually moves the numbers.

LDL gets a lot of attention for a reason. Over time, LDL particles that linger in the bloodstream can slip beneath the artery lining and kick off plaque formation.

Medication can help in high-risk cases, but many people can move the needle with targeted lifestyle changes first.

Below is a straightforward plan that focuses on how LDL is produced, cleared, and modified in your body, then shows you what to change day to day.

What Are Statins?

Statins block HMG-CoA reductase, a liver enzyme your body uses to make cholesterol. That lowers LDL in the blood and reduces cardiovascular risk for the right patients.

Common side effects include muscle aches, digestive upset, and rarely liver issues or changes in blood sugar. If you are already on a statin, do not stop it on your own. If you are deciding, it helps to know there are non-drug levers that also lower risk.

Why LDL Rises In The First Place

Think of LDL as a delivery van carrying cholesterol to tissues. You can affect both how many vans you send out and how fast you retrieve them.

  • Production rises with excess calories, refined carbs, and certain fats. The liver turns surplus energy into triglycerides, loads them into VLDL, and those remodel into LDL.

  • Clearance slows when LDL receptors on liver cells are scarce or sluggish. Insulin resistance, low thyroid function, and chronic inflammation can all blunt receptor activity, leaving more LDL in circulation.

  • Particle quality matters. Diet patterns shift LDL toward smaller, denser particles that are more likely to penetrate the artery wall. Rebalancing fats and cutting added sugars can push things in a better direction.

The Non-Statin Toolkit

  1. Swap the fats, keep the flavor

Replace butter and fatty cuts with extra virgin olive oil, nuts, seeds, and fish most days. This single change can lower LDL and ApoB while improving the overall lipid pattern.

If you eat dairy, favor fermented low-fat options. Keep industrial trans fats off your plate entirely.

  1. Make soluble fiber non-negotiable

Soluble fibers bind bile acids in the gut. Your body then pulls cholesterol from circulation to make more bile, which lowers LDL. Aim for 10 to 15 grams of soluble fiber daily from oats or barley, psyllium husk, beans, lentils, chia, ground flax, apples, and citrus. Psyllium is a simple, proven add-on with meals.

  1. Add plant sterols and stanols with purpose

Two grams per day of plant sterols or stanols can lower LDL by reducing intestinal absorption of cholesterol. You can reach this with fortified foods or supplements alongside meals. They work best layered onto a solid diet, not as a shortcut.

  1. Tame refined carbs and added sugar

A high-sugar pattern drives liver fat and ramps up VLDL output, which later becomes LDL. Build meals around protein, vegetables, fruit, legumes, and intact grains. Keep sugary drinks, pastries, and ultra-refined snacks for rare occasions.

  1. Move more, most days

Brisk walking after meals, resistance training two to three times a week, and regular aerobic work improve insulin sensitivity and lipid handling. The effect compounds with fiber and fat swaps. Even short post-meal walks help.

  1. Lose a little, gain a lot

If you carry extra abdominal fat, a 5% to 10% weight loss can meaningfully lower LDL and triglycerides while raising HDL. No crash diets needed. Cut liquid calories, anchor each meal with protein, and bias your plate toward high-fiber plants.

  1. Support bile flow and recycling

Your body disposes of cholesterol by turning it into bile acids. You can help this loop by getting enough glycine and taurine from protein sources, eating soluble fiber to limit bile reabsorption, and keeping your bowels regular. The end result is more cholesterol pulled from circulation.

Where Statins Fit

For people with very high LDL, diabetes, or existing cardiovascular disease, statins can be lifesaving. They reduce LDL powerfully and predictably.

Side effects are usually mild, though muscle pain, rare muscle breakdown, liver enzyme changes, and small shifts in blood sugar can occur.

If medication is on the table, the lifestyle steps above still matter and make the medication work better.

Final Word

Lowering LDL without statins is not about a single superfood. It is about shrinking the liver’s output of cholesterol-rich particles, speeding their clearance, and keeping the artery wall calm.

Swap the fats, stack soluble fiber and plant sterols, move daily, and trim refined carbs.

Those small, repeatable choices add up to a real change in your numbers and your long-term risk.
